Introduction

Are you planning a memorable trip to Morocco in 2025? While cities like Marrakech and Fes often steal the spotlight, the capital city of Rabat offers a completely different vibe that might surprise you. Rabat combines rich history, stunning coastal scenery, modern art, and a calm, relaxed atmosphere. All of it adds to make it a hidden gem, which is worth exploring.

If you have ever dreamed of wandering through quiet and colorful medina alleys. Sipping mint tea while watching the Atlantic waves or discovering ancient palaces and lush gardens without big tourist crowds, this travel guide is for you. In this detailed travel blog, we have mentioned all the top things to do in Rabat. Along with insider tips, cost breakdowns, local hacks, and practical advice. By the end, you will be fully prepared to experience Rabat like a local. This guide can help you to create unforgettable memories in Morocco’s beautiful capital.

An Overview of Things to do in Rabat

An Overview of Things to do in Rabat

"Things to do in Rabat" isn’t just about ticking boxes on a tourist map. In 2025, it means truly experiencing the city’s blend of ancient heritage, modern creativity, and laid-back coastal lifestyle. Rabat is Morocco’s political and administrative capital, and while it may not be as chaotic or colorful as Marrakech. It stands out for its sophisticated charm, wide open spaces, and peaceful neighborhoods. You won’t find endless crowds or aggressive street vendors here. Instead, you will stroll down palm-lined boulevards, explore carefully maintained historical sites, and enjoy a coastal breeze. You can also discover markets, gardens, and museums at your own pace.

What makes Rabat even more special is its harmonious mix of cultures. You can see European-style architecture standing side by side with Islamic art and Andalusian gardens. The city feels both timeless and refreshingly modern. From the medieval walls of the Kasbah of the Udayas to the contemporary galleries downtown, Rabat’s attractions cater to everyone. Whether you love history, art, food, or just relaxing by the sea, it is a perfect holiday destination. In 2025, Rabat continues to evolve with new pedestrian zones, art spaces, trendy cafés, and family-friendly public areas. It’s a city designed for wandering and discovering hidden surprises around every corner.

Suggested Read: Morocco Travel Guide: Best Restaurants, Cafes & Attractions to Explore

Top 12 Things to Do in Rabat

1. Explore the Kasbah of the Udayas

Explore the Kasbah of the Udayas

Wander through its beautiful blue-and-white streets, visit the Andalusian Gardens, and enjoy panoramic views of the Atlantic Ocean. It’s one of the most iconic spots in Rabat.

2. Visit Hassan Tower and the Mausoleum of Mohammed V

Visit Hassan Tower and the Mausoleum of Mohammed V


See the impressive unfinished minaret from the 12th century and the stunning mausoleum with its intricate mosaics and royal guards. This is a must-see for anyone interested in Moroccan history and architecture.

Suggested Read: Best Things to Do in RIF Mountains for Tourists

3. Stroll through the Medina of Rabat

Stroll through the Medina of Rabat


Shop for local crafts, leather products, rugs, spices, and jewelry. Compared to other Moroccan cities, Rabat’s medina is quieter and easier to navigate.

4. Relax at Rabat Beach (Plage de Rabat)

Relax at Rabat Beach (Plage de Rabat)


Spend an afternoon enjoying the sandy shore, try surfing, or simply watch the sunset from a seaside café.

Suggested Read: Top Adventure Activities to Enjoy at Atlas Mountains

5. Visit Chellah Necropolis

Visit Chellah Necropolis


Explore this ancient Roman and medieval site full of crumbling walls, gardens, and stork nests. It’s a peaceful and mysterious place perfect for history lovers and photographers.

6. Check out the Mohammed VI Museum of Modern and Contemporary Art

Check out the Mohammed VI Museum of Modern and Contemporary Art


See impressive collections of Moroccan and international artworks. The museum also hosts temporary exhibitions and workshops.

Suggested Read: Top Places to Visit in Tangier, Morocco

7. Walk or cycle along the Bouregreg River

Walk or cycle along the Bouregreg River


Enjoy the waterfront promenades, rent a bike, or take a small boat tour to see Rabat and nearby Salé from a new perspective.

8. Visit the Royal Palace (Dar al-Makhzen) from the outside

Visit the Royal Palace (Dar al-Makhzen) from the outside


While you can’t enter, you can admire the impressive gates and beautifully maintained gardens around the palace area.

Suggested Read: Islands in Morocco for a Perfect Coastal Retreat

9. Visit the Rabat Zoo (Jardin Zoologique National)

Visit the Rabat Zoo (Jardin Zoologique National)


A great choice for families, the zoo is home to various African animals in natural-style enclosures.

10. Attend a local festival or event

Attend a local festival or event


If visiting in summer, check out the Mawazine music festival or smaller cultural events celebrating Moroccan arts and music.

Suggested Read: Uncover the Best Places to Visit in Rabat for Your Next Trip

11. Enjoy traditional Moroccan cuisine at local restaurants

Enjoy traditional Moroccan cuisine at local restaurants


Try dishes like lamb tagine with prunes, seafood pastilla, or couscous with vegetables. Finish with fresh mint tea and Moroccan pastries.

12. Spend time in Rabat’s lush parks and gardens

Spend time in Rabat’s lush parks and gardens


Visit Jardin d'Essais Botaniques, a large botanical garden ideal for a quiet break from sightseeing.

Step-by-Step Guide to Exploring Things to do in Rabat

Step 1: Plan Your Arrival

Most travelers arrive at Rabat-Salé International Airport, which is only about 20 minutes from the city center. You can also take Morocco’s efficient train network from major cities like Casablanca (about 1 hour), Tangier (around 1.5 hours by high-speed train), or Marrakech (approximately 4 hours).

When choosing where to stay, consider the medina if you want an authentic, traditional experience. If you prefer a more modern, peaceful vibe, opt for hotels or guesthouses near the Hassan neighborhood or close to the beach. Many travelers love staying in the riads. These are beautifully restored traditional Moroccan houses with central courtyards. Book now for a unique and cozy stay.

Step 2: Discover the Medina

Unlike the chaotic and maze-like medinas of Marrakech and Fes, Rabat’s medina feels more organized and less overwhelming. Enter through the iconic Bab el Had gate and you will find a calm world of narrow alleys filled with local shops. You can shop for almost everything from carpets and leather goods to fragrant spices and silver jewelry.

Don’t miss the chance to visit small cafés tucked away inside the medina. Try traditional Moroccan mint tea paired with sweet pastries like chebakia or msemen. The Medina is also a great place to observe local culture. You can look at craftsmen at work, see families shopping for fresh produce, and hear the call to prayer echoing softly in the distance.

Step 3: Visit Historical Landmarks

Rabat is home to some of Morocco’s most significant historical sites. Start at the Kasbah of the Udayas, a picturesque fortress from the 12th century. Wander through its narrow blue-and-white streets that feel similar to Chefchaouen. Do not forget to visit the Andalusian Gardens inside. The kasbah’s terraces offer panoramic views of the Atlantic Ocean and the Bouregreg River.

Next, head to Hassan Tower, an unfinished minaret that was meant to be the tallest in the world. Nearby stands the Mausoleum of Mohammed V, a beautifully decorated resting place of Morocco’s beloved king and his sons. The white marble, green tiled roof, and detailed carvings make this site one of the country’s most impressive architectural wonders.

While in this area, you can also explore Chellah, an ancient Roman and medieval necropolis. Chellah’s peaceful ruins are filled with storks’ nests, flowering gardens, and crumbling old walls that can take you back in time.

Step 4: Relax at the Waterfront

After exploring the history, head to Rabat’s lively waterfront. The Bouregreg Marina is the perfect place to walk along the river and enjoy food at modern cafés with views of the neighboring city of Salé. You can rent a kayak or take a small boat to see the city from the water. A visit to Rabat wouldn’t be complete without spending time at its primary beaches. Plage de Rabat is a must visit beach. While not as famous as other Moroccan beaches, it offers golden sand, gentle waves, and plenty of local charm. Join locals for a game of football or just stretch out under an umbrella with your favorite book.

To enjoy the sunset, grab a seat at one of the cliff-top cafés near the kasbah and watch the changing colors of the sky. It’s one of the most magical moments you can experience in the city.

Step 5: Experience Modern Rabat

Rabat isn’t just about its past. The city has a lively modern side that’s constantly growing. Visit the Mohammed VI Museum of Modern and Contemporary Art. It is the first large-scale museum of its kind in Morocco. Here you will find works from Moroccan and international artists, and the building itself is an architectural gem.

Don’t miss walking down Avenue Mohammed V, where modern shops, bookstores, and French-style cafés line the streets. You will also find trendy restaurants offering everything from classic Moroccan tagines to sushi and fusion cuisine.

If you are lucky to be in Rabat during the Mawazine music festival (usually held in June), you will experience one of Africa’s biggest music events, attracting international stars and local artists alike. The festival transforms the city into a giant open-air party. It’s a fantastic way to see Rabat’s youthful, creative energy.

Suggested Read: Top Cafes in Morocco with Best Views and Great Atmosphere

Key Features & Benefits

  • Easy navigation: The city’s layout makes it simple to explore by walking, tram, or bike.
  • Cultural mix: Enjoy a rare combination of Islamic, Andalusian, and French influences.
  • Affordable: Entrance fees to most attractions are budget-friendly, along with affordable food.
  • Multilingual: Arabic and French are widely spoken, and many people understand English in tourist areas.
  • Family and solo-friendly: Safe, calm streets make it welcoming for families and solo travelers.
  • Coastal atmosphere: Enjoy fresh sea air, oceanfront walks, and beach relaxation without leaving the city.

Fare & Pricing Information (2025)

Attractions and Costs
Attraction/Service Approximate Cost
Kasbah of the Udayas Free
Museum entries (average) 30 – 60 MAD
Chellah ruins 70 MAD
Mausoleum of Mohammed V Free
Half-day guided city tour 300 – 500 MAD
Beach umbrella & chair rental 50 – 80 MAD
Tram ride (one way) 6 MAD
Boat rental (1 hour) 150 – 250 MAD

Most activities are quite affordable compared to European or American cities, making Rabat an attractive choice for budget-conscious travelers.

Follow These Insider Tips for Enjoying Things to do in Rabat

Follow These Insider Tips for Enjoying Things to do in Rabat

Wear comfortable shoes, you will have to walk a lot on cobbled streets and sandy areas.

  • While credit cards are accepted in larger restaurants and hotels, Medina shops usually prefer cash. It is better to carry cash.
  • Respect local dress codes. While Rabat is more chill than some other Moroccan cities, modest clothing is appreciated.
  • Try taking the tram at least once. It’s clean, affordable, and gives you a great city tour.
  • For a local lunch, try a small family-run eatery (called a "snack") where you can enjoy a hearty meal for around 30–50 MAD.

Quick Travel Essentials

  • Transport: Options include trams, "petit taxis" (small red taxis), buses, and walking.
  • Languages: Arabic and French are the main languages; English is common in hotels and tourist places.
  • Currency: Moroccan dirham (MAD); ATMs are widely available, but smaller places prefer cash.
  • Time zone: GMT+1 (Daylight Saving Time observed).
  • Emergency numbers: Police – 19, Ambulance – 15, Fire – 15.
  • Weather: Mild winters, warm summers; spring and autumn are the best seasons to visit.
Suggested Read: Best Restaurants in Morocco to Satisfy the Foodie in You

Final Thoughts

Exploring all the things to do in Rabat is a refreshing way to see a different side of Morocco. While other cities overwhelm with their intense energy, Rabat invites you to feel the vibe. Breathe in the ocean air and discover history and modern life side by side. You can enjoy a peaceful walk through ancient kasbahs or just explore modern art galleries. Enjoy refreshing orange juice on a sunny boulevard. Rabat offers endless ways to connect with Moroccan culture. Rabat stands out as a perfect destination for travelers who want authenticity without chaos. Beauty without over-commercialization, and cultural richness without rushing. Whether you are planning your first trip to Morocco or looking for a new adventure, Rabat promises to deliver experiences you will remember for a lifetime. Get ready to pack your bags, put on your shoes to enjoy a promising holiday in Morocco.

Things to do in Rabat - FAQ’s

Q1. How can I book activities in Rabat?

You can book tours and activities through hotel desks, local agencies in the medina, or online platforms like GetYourGuide. Many walking tours or day trips can also be arranged directly in the city.

Q2. Are there extra charges at attractions?

Most attractions charge small entry fees, with some sites free. Special exhibitions or private guided tours may cost more, but prices are generally very reasonable.

Q3. Is Rabat safe for solo and family travelers?

Yes! Rabat is one of Morocco’s safest cities and is known for its calm, friendly vibe. You can comfortably explore alone or with family, even at night in main areas.

Q4. What languages are spoken in Rabat?

Arabic and French are most common, but English is widely understood in tourist-focused shops, hotels, and restaurants.

Q5. Can I explore Rabat on my own?

Absolutely. Rabat is very walkable and easy to navigate, with clear signage and a modern tram system. Exploring solo is fun and gives you flexibility to discover hidden gems.